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Finlayson's squirrel | Pallas's Leaf Warbler |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ordates)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Aves (Birds) |
| Order | Rodentia (Rodents) | Passeriformes (Songbirds) |
| Family | Sciuridae (Squirrels) | Phylloscopidae |
| Genus | Callosciurus | Phylloscopus |
| Species | Callosciurus finlaysonii | Phylloscopus proregulus |
Evolutionary Relationship
Finlayson's squirrel and Pallas's Leaf Warbler share a common ancestor at the Phylum level: Chordata. (Chordates)
